Re: programming
If you want to start with Java, try downloading the SDK from the Sun website. You can edit java in any text editor, even Notepad, but there are many free tools that might help you such as an IDE like Eclipse. The Sun website has many good tutorials for beginners to advanced programmers, and there are many more free tutorials out there, google will provide many links.

Re: programming
There is no such thing as "programming computers". there are different languages that we can compile into binary that the computer reads. So basically think of a program or software as instructions for the computer to do something. If you are a beginner, do not start with C++, as it is more difficult than most languages, although once you get the hang of programming, C++ would be the right way to go, trust me. but, until you have a strong programming background you might want to try a easier language like VB or C#.
